mirror of
https://github.com/bitcoin/bitcoin.git
synced 2025-04-29 14:59:39 -04:00
cli: improve bitcoin-cli error when not connected
Adds a string suggestion `bitcoin-cli -help` as an additional source of information.
This commit is contained in:
parent
bf1b6383db
commit
69d6fd676e
1 changed files with 4 additions and 1 deletions
|
@ -827,7 +827,10 @@ static UniValue CallRPC(BaseRequestHandler* rh, const std::string& strMethod, co
|
||||||
if (response.error != -1) {
|
if (response.error != -1) {
|
||||||
responseErrorMessage = strprintf(" (error code %d - \"%s\")", response.error, http_errorstring(response.error));
|
responseErrorMessage = strprintf(" (error code %d - \"%s\")", response.error, http_errorstring(response.error));
|
||||||
}
|
}
|
||||||
throw CConnectionFailed(strprintf("Could not connect to the server %s:%d%s\n\nMake sure the bitcoind server is running and that you are connecting to the correct RPC port.", host, port, responseErrorMessage));
|
throw CConnectionFailed(strprintf("Could not connect to the server %s:%d%s\n\n"
|
||||||
|
"Make sure the bitcoind server is running and that you are connecting to the correct RPC port.\n"
|
||||||
|
"Use \"bitcoin-cli -help\" for more info.",
|
||||||
|
host, port, responseErrorMessage));
|
||||||
} else if (response.status == HTTP_UNAUTHORIZED) {
|
} else if (response.status == HTTP_UNAUTHORIZED) {
|
||||||
if (failedToGetAuthCookie) {
|
if (failedToGetAuthCookie) {
|
||||||
throw std::runtime_error(strprintf(
|
throw std::runtime_error(strprintf(
|
||||||
|
|
Loading…
Add table
Reference in a new issue